Output 850f29bfe3e4094f6b1f91de52c19a8d3e28bc71e609a94cd23103b14e8cf56c:5

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 c56b165a444c2e65551214fd689e2ddc97d8b4cd
address
bc1qc443vkjyfshx24gjzn7k383dmjta3dxd5hzkue
transaction
850f29bfe3e4094f6b1f91de52c19a8d3e28bc71e609a94cd23103b14e8cf56c